Greg Lopez is lecturer at the Murdoch Business School and holder of a Ph.D. in economics from the Australian National University. Lopez's research investigates into the intricate dynamics between the state, political regimes, societies, and markets, particularly focusing on leadership, strategy, and innovation. Specialising in the political economy of Malaysia, Lopez addresses the challenges of sustainable development, economic growth, innovation, and entrepreneurship in the context of poverty, inequality, corruption, racism, and religious fundamentalism.
